Arrange the following in correct order and complete the chain.

1) Physiographic divisions of India from north to south

- Deccan Plateau- the Vindhyas- The Himalayas – The Northern

Plains- The Satpuras

2) Physiographic divisions of Brazil from north west to south east

- Brazilian Highlands- The Great Escarpment – Guyana Highlands –

Amazon Plains

3) Arrange according to increasing population distribution

Andhra Pradesh – Uttar Pradesh – Himachal Pradesh – Madhya Pradesh

4) Arrange according to decreasing amount of rainfall in Brazil

Pernambuco – Rio Grande do Sul-Amazonas – Roraima

Answers

Answered by sailorking
70

1) The Himalayas , The Northern , Plains-The satpuras , The Vindhyas , Deccan Plateau

2) Guyana Highlands , Amazon Plains , Brazilian Highlands , The great Escarpment

3)Himachal Pradesh ( 68.6 lakh ) , Andhra Pradesh ( 4.97 crore ) , Madhya Pradesh ( 7.33 crore ) , Uttar Pradesh ( 20.42 crore )

4)Amazonas ( 2300 mm ) , Pernambuco( 1691 mm ) , Roraima ( 1534 mm ) , Rio Grande do Sul-Amazonas ( 1464 mm )
